The Environmental Protection Agency (EPA) requires that cities monitor over 80 contaminants in their drinking water. Samples from the Lake Huron Water Treatment Plant gave the results shown here. Only the range is reported, not the mean (presumably the mean would be the midrange). (a) For each substance, estimate the standard deviation σ by using one of the methods shown in Table 8.11 in Section 8.7. (b) Why might an estimate of σ be helpful in planning future water sample testing?
Substance | MCLG Range Detected | Allowable MCLG | Origin of Substance |
Chromium | 0.47 to 0.69 | 100 | Discharge for steel and pulp mills, natural erosion |
Selenium | 0 to 0.0014 | 50 | Corrosion of household plumbing, leaching from wood preservatives, natural erosion |
Barium | 0.004 to 0.019 | 2 | Discharge from drilling wastes, metal refineries, natural erosion |
Fluoride | 1.07 to 1.17 | 4.0 | Natural erosion, water additive, discharge from fertilizer and aluminum factories |
MCLG = Maximum contaminant level goal
